The first step to add an electric fireplace to your home is to measure the space where you'd like to install it. Be sure that the area is big enough to accommodate both the fireplace and other furniture in the room. Once you've found the right location, it's time to get started on the installation process.

It is necessary to take out the old fireplace and clean out any debris in the area. It is recommended to do this before you begin installing the new fireplace. Mark the wall holes when the space is prepared. To locate the studs, it is recommended to use the stud finder. Once you've determined the places for the mounting brackets, it's time to install them and then screw them using drywall anchors or screws.

Before you install the fireplace, check that it works properly by plugging it into an electrical outlet and playing with the LED lights and heat. You can mount the fireplace on the wall if everything is functioning properly.

Most electric fireplaces have to be mounted onto a bracket which is then fixed to the wall. Some fireplaces are fixed directly into the wall. To ensure your fireplace is mounted securely, it's best to follow the installation instructions in your owner's manual. If you're not sure of what to do, it may be beneficial to employ an expert to handle the installation for you.

Appearances that are Stylish

You don't need to worry about chimneys or gas lines when using an electric fireplace that is wall-mounted. All you need to connect it to the wall and enjoy the ambiance of its LED flames and the ember bed. The majority of models come with the option of a remote control that allows you to customize the settings, and adjust the brightness and color of the fire. Some models have an inbuilt heater that can provide additional heating up to 400 square feet.

The most popular styles for electric fireplaces are flush-mounted and recessed units. A recessed model is positioned inside a hole of the wall. It could require professional installation.

If you are a DIY enthusiast, you can install a flush-mounted device right on your wall. However, it's best to check with the manufacturer to make sure that it is in compliance with the local building codes.

Certain models come with additional features like crackling and fake smoke. You can also select from a range of surround options to suit your home's decor. Some surrounds feature double-glass designs that help reduce radiation heat and makes them more secure for pets and small children.
